QUOTE(RokXIII @ Jun 7 2016, 11:15 PM)
for direct shipping, each side of the parcel cannot be more than 80cm, and sum up of 3 sides (HxWxL) cannot be more than 120cm, and the weight is 15KG.
either you could ask the seller help u to re-package the parcel (take away the big box, put all the parts inside into another smaller box)
or get agent help you on that..

i nearly encounter the same when i ordered 7111, luckily the seller did ask me whats the limitation of the parcel's measurement before he shipped it out.
